VI. Working time
1. The daily regular working time amounts to 8 hours and lies between 6:00 and 20: 00 h. The weekly regular working time is 40 hours and is normally split on 5 working days. The regular working time shall be calculated if a shorter time has to be kept to for reasons which KCS GmbH shall not be responsible for. The personnel of KCS GmbH shall take into account Customer’s special operational situation and local situations with regard to the individual definition of working time.
2. Such working hours being performed beyond the regular weekly and daily respectively working time are seen as extra work. Such extra work shall only be allowed under mutual agreement. Such extra work should exceed the daily working time by not more than 2 hours and the regular weekly working time by not more than 10 hours.
3. Night work is that work being performed between 20:00 h and 6:00. Any working hours being performed during this nighttime shall be deemed to be extra work.
4. Any work performed on Sundays and public holidays between 0:00 h and 24:00 h shall be deemed to be work on Sundays and public holidays. Such days with a general rest from work at the working place shall be deemed to be Sundays and public holidays. Such work on Sundays and public holidays is only allowed in urgent cases and under mutual agreement.

XIII. Warranty
1. KCS GmbH grants warranty for its professional and careful work for the period of 12 months, but for the maximum of 2.500 operating hours after the completion of work according to the conditions hereinafter mentioned.
2. Should work be interrupted for reasons as mentioned in point 10.3., the warranty period shall start for such work completed prior to the interruption for three months after the beginning of the interruption at the latest.
3. Such defective work at the objects, plants, etc. at which work was carried out, shall be removed free of charge, if they are discovered during the warranty period, provided that KCS GmbH is informed in writing immediately after its discovery. KCS GmbH shall only assume warranty for defects due to work of Customer’s personnel or one third party charged by Customer, even under supervision of KCS GmbH’s personnel, if such defects are due to gross negligence of KCS GmbH’s personnel when executing the instruction or supervision.
4. Warranty expires if Customer or third party make a change or repair without any approval in writing by KCS GmbH; if other than original parts are used which were delivered by KCS GmbH or if Customer does not take prompt and appropriate steps to minimize any damage.
5. For rectification work within the frame of warranty KCS GmbH shall assume warranty to the same extent like for the original work, but not beyond this applicable time of warranty.
6. Any further-going claims and rights due to any defects other than such ones mentioned under points 13.1 to 13.5 shall be excluded.
